Transaction 99655e4597cf1ef795bd96e7e6ebe90989d704ffe3214016b4e086f01c9a5966
1 Input
1 Output
-
99655e4597cf1ef795bd96e7e6ebe90989d704ffe3214016b4e086f01c9a5966:0
- value
- 438220
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8665b4b165001088fd2cbf65ba47fff5b6363cb0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DFdPMKc4yUwqtk6ThoYGGcKdYseuiz6CC